mysql怎么在数字前补零

更新时间:02-08 教程 由 画青笺ぶ 分享

在MySQL中,如果需要在数字前补零,我们通常可以使用LPAD函数。它可以用于将指定的字符串填充到另一个字符串的左边。

下面是一个使用LPAD函数在数字前补零的示例:

SELECT LPAD(5, 2, 0); -- 输出结果为 "05"

在这个例子中,我们将数字5填充到2个字符的长度,并使用0作为填充字符。因此,输出结果为 "05"。

如果我们需要将数字列中的所有数字前面加上0,则可以使用LPAD和LENGTH函数来实现。下面是一个示例:

SELECT LPAD(column_name, LENGTH(column_name)+1, 0)FROM table_name;

在这个例子中,我们首先使用LENGTH函数获取数字列的长度,然后将其加1,以确保它具有足够的宽度来包含前导0。最后,我们使用LPAD函数将前导0添加到数字列中的每个数字。

希望这篇文章对你有所帮助!

声明:关于《mysql怎么在数字前补零》以上内容仅供参考,若您的权利被侵害,请联系13825271@qq.com
本文网址:http://www.25820.com/tutorial/14_2247627.html